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from London Bridge to Folkestone Central start from as little as £12.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from London Bridge to Folkestone Central start from £33.00 one way, or £33.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from London Bridge to Folkestone Central are available for £44.20 one way, or £45.40 return

Facilities and Amenities at London Bridge Station

London Bridge Station is equipped with a wide array of facilities aimed at enhancing the traveler experience. Ticketing services are comprehensive, with a ticket office open from the early hours of 04:45 until 01:00 the following morning on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 05:25 on Sundays. Travelers can also find numerous ticket machines throughout the station, making ticket purchase quick and convenient.

For those who might need assistance, there is a strong support system in place. Staff is available to help each day from 04:00 to 01:00, and customer help points are strategically placed for easy access. Moreover, the station is designed to be fully accessible, featuring step-free access across all platforms via lifts, ensuring a seamless experience for all passengers.

Whether you’re feeling peckish or need a quick caffeine fix, the station's concourse boasts a variety of food and drink options. From cozy cafes with seating to bustling food kiosks, there are plenty of choices to suit every palate. ATMs are conveniently located on both the lower and upper concourses, allowing you to manage your travel finances with ease.

Onward Travel Options from London Bridge Station

This hub isn't just limited to train journeys. The station connects to multiple modes of transport, enhancing its role as a travel nexus. Buses are readily accessible from the station’s main entrance and also from Tooley Street. There is a taxi rank situated right outside the main doors, providing quick rides to your next destination.

For those who prefer cycling, while there isn’t an official hire service within the station, nearby Duke Street Hill provides convenient bicycle rentals. Additionally, London Bridge Station extends its reach to airports, with direct train connections to Gatwick and Luton Airports, appealing to international travelers.

Facilities at Folkestone Central

Stepping into Folkestone Central, you're greeted by a welcoming environment that caters to all your travel necessities. For those purchasing or collecting tickets, the station boasts a ticket office open from Monday to Saturday, 6:00 to 19:00, and on Sundays from 8:10 to 17:40. Ticket machines are available for added convenience, with the capability to collect pre-booked tickets. Accessibility is a priority here, with an induction loop and accessible ticket machines located in the booking hall.

For individuals requiring assistance, there are customer help points and detailed staff support available. Travel information features through comprehensive departure screens and announcements, ensuring you are always updated with the latest schedule information. While luggage storage isn't available, you can rest easy knowing CCTV is in operation for enhanced security.

Passengers with mobility needs can navigate the station effortlessly thanks to step-free access across all platforms. Facilities such as accessible toilets, ramps for train access, and wheelchairs ensure a barrier-free environment. The station also offers four accessible parking spaces, although accessible car park equipment is not installed. Heated waiting rooms and adequate seating areas make waiting for your train a comfortable experience.
